[0013] The following description relates to a system and method for a urea mixer configured to receive urea injection from an ejector. The urea mixer can be positioned upstream of the SCR catalyst, such as figure 1 Shown. The urea mixer includes an upstream part positioned outside the exhaust pipe and a downstream part positioned inside the exhaust pipe, such as figure 2 Shown. The downstream portion is physically coupled to the inner surface of the exhaust pipe, wherein the opening is positioned around the central axis of the exhaust pipe. The downstream part further includes a plurality of perforations on the curved surface of the downstream part. The hole is positioned between the inner surface of the exhaust pipe and the opening on the curved surface, such as image 3 Shown. In this way, the exhaust gas flows through the opening or perforation when it reaches the downstream portion. Figure 4 An example exhaust flow through a urea mixer is shown in. Technical field [0001] This specification relates generally to methods and systems for urea mixers. Background technique [0002] A technology for aftertreatment of engine exhaust uses selective catalytic reduction (SCR) to reduce the NO in exhaust x And ammonia (NH 3 ) Some chemical reactions occur between. By injecting urea into the exhaust channel, NH 3 Introduce into the engine exhaust system upstream of the SCR catalyst, or generate NH in the upstream catalyst 3 . Urea decomposes into NH entropy under high temperature conditions 3 . SCR helps NH 3 And NO x The reaction between the NO x Converted into nitrogen (N 2 ) And water (H 2 O). However, as recognized by the present inventors, problems can arise when injecting urea into the exhaust path.
